Article 1.Who we are and what DriverX does
DriverX is a technology platform developed and operated by Techno Services LLC, a
company incorporated in the United States of America, with its address at 504 Pinto Pony Dr,
Ashland, Missouri 65010.
DriverX acts solely as a technology intermediary. Its role is to connect a
person requesting a ride with available independent drivers, and to provide the tools needed to
agree on a price, follow the route, communicate and keep a record of what happened.
DriverX does not:
- provide the transportation service;
- own or manage the vehicles;
- employ the drivers;
- receive, hold or transfer the trip fare;
- unilaterally set the final price, which is agreed between the parties.
The transportation contract is entered into directly between the passenger and the driver.
DriverX is not a party to that contract, and its involvement is limited to what these Terms
describe.

Article 6.How a trip works
The flow, as the Platform actually operates, is as follows:
- The passenger enters origin and destination, and the Platform calculates a suggested price.
- The passenger confirms that price or proposes another, and the request is published to eligible nearby drivers.
- Drivers may accept the price or submit a counteroffer.
- When both sides agree on an amount, the trip is confirmed and assigned to that driver.
- The driver heads to the pickup point; the passenger sees their location in real time and receives proximity and arrival notices.
- The journey takes place and the driver marks the trip as finished.
- Payment is recorded and both parties may rate each other.
Neither passenger nor driver is obliged to accept any particular request or offer. The Platform
does not guarantee that a driver will be available at a given time or place, nor any maximum
waiting time.
The times, distances and routes shown in the app are estimates based on map providers and may
differ from reality due to traffic, roadworks, weather or road conditions.
Article 7.Suggested price and negotiation
The suggested price combines:
- a base fare;
- the estimated distance of the route;
- the estimated duration;
- a demand factor, when an area has more requests than available drivers;
- a minimum fare, below which the price does not fall.
The demand factor works in tiers and has a maximum cap. It is never applied without limit. The
specific parameters —base fare, per-kilometre rate, minimum and demand cap— vary by market and
vehicle type, and the result is always shown to the passenger before
requesting the trip.
The suggested price is a negotiable reference, not an imposed tariff. The
passenger may offer a different amount and the driver may accept it or counteroffer. The
passenger's offer must fall within the minimum and maximum range the app shows on screen. The
Platform also limits how many offers each side may make and sets a validity period for each;
once that margin is used up, the request must be started again.
The final price is the amount both sides agree on. Once the trip is confirmed,
that price does not change due to traffic or delays. If the passenger asks to change the
destination mid-journey, that must be agreed with the driver; the Platform does not
automatically recalculate a price already agreed.
Article 8.Paying for the trip
The final price is paid by the passenger directly to the driver. Techno Services
LLC does not receive, hold or administer that money at any point.
Cash
Cash is the enabled payment method. When the trip ends, the Platform asks both parties to
confirm that payment was made, within a period shown on screen.
- If both confirm, the trip is recorded as paid.
- If either party states that payment was not made, a dispute is opened automatically.
- If the period expires without confirmation, a dispute is also opened automatically.
Disputes are handled under Article 17.
Other payment methods
Card and other electronic payment methods are not enabled. Even if the app
displays the option, the system rejects the transaction and the trip must be settled in cash.
When an electronic method is enabled, this will be announced in advance, the payment processor
will be identified, and these Terms will be updated before it goes live.
DriverX does not issue invoices for the trip fare, because it is not the provider of the
transportation service. Any tax receipt for the journey is the driver's responsibility, under
the rules that apply to them.
Article 9.Driver wallet and commission
Drivers pay DriverX a commission for each confirmed trip. It is the only
revenue the Platform takes from the transaction and is calculated as a percentage of the final
agreed price.
The commission is deducted from the driver's wallet, a prepaid balance within
the Platform. It works as follows:
- The driver tops up the wallet through the methods DriverX makes available.
- To receive requests, the driver must keep a minimum operating balance, visible in the app.
- The applicable commission percentage is disclosed to the driver in the app, and every charge is itemized in the wallet history alongside the trip that generated it.
- The commission is charged when the trip is confirmed. If the balance is insufficient, the trip cannot be accepted.
- If the trip is cancelled, the commission is refunded in full to the wallet, regardless of who cancelled.
Every movement —top-ups, commission charges and refunds— is recorded in the wallet history,
available in the app.
The wallet balance may only be used to pay commissions. It bears no interest, is not a bank
deposit and does not constitute electronic money. On account closure, DriverX will coordinate
with the driver what happens to any remaining balance and any outstanding obligation, under
Article 22.
The commission percentage and the minimum balance may change. Any change is communicated with
reasonable notice and does not apply to trips already confirmed.
Article 10.Cancellations
Either party may cancel a trip while it has not finished.
Cancellation without consequences
No penalty applies when cancelling:
- before the trip is confirmed, that is, while a driver is being searched for or the price is being negotiated;
- within the free window after confirmation, whose length is shown in the app.
Passenger cancellation outside the window
A penalty is recorded against the account. Since the trip fare is currently paid in cash
directly to the driver, DriverX has no means of collecting that penalty: it is
recorded in the account history and may be taken into account to restrict access to the
service in case of repetition. If a payment method that allows collection is enabled in the
future, this will be announced before it is applied.
Driver cancellation outside the window
This directly affects the driver's reputation and continuity on the Platform:
- their average rating is reduced, more severely if the trip was already under way;
- their cancellation rate rises, which weighs on trip assignment order;
- exceeding the maximum number of cancellations allowed in twenty-four hours results in automatic suspension of the account.
In all cases, the commission charged is refunded to the driver. Cancelling for safety reasons
—a risky situation, a passenger in a condition that prevents safe transport, a broken-down
vehicle— should not be penalised: the cancellation should be reported through the channels in
Article 14 so that the case can be reviewed.
Article 11.Ratings
At the end of a trip, passenger and driver may rate each other on a scale of one to five stars.
Each side rates once per trip, and only for finished trips. A one-star rating requires a
reason.
A driver's average rating influences trip assignment order, and a persistently low rating may
lead to limitation or suspension of the account under Article 15.
Ratings and comments must relate to the trip experience. DriverX may remove a comment
containing insults, threats, third-party personal data or discriminatory content, and may
disregard a rating where there are reasonable indications of retaliation or manipulation.
Article 12.Trip chat and privacy of the parties
Communication between passenger and driver takes place through the Platform's
internal chat, which is enabled only while a trip is active and closes when it
ends.
This is deliberate: the internal chat means neither party has to share their personal phone
number to arrange a pickup. Using the chat to request the other party's phone number, social
media profile or other contact details for purposes unrelated to the trip is
prohibited.
For the same reason, the app blocks screenshots in conversations. Publishing,
circulating or sharing the conversation, photograph, name, licence plate or any other detail of
the other party outside the Platform is a serious breach and results in permanent blocking of
the account, without prejudice to any legal action that may follow.
Trip messages may be attached to a report by the person making it, so that the support team can
assess what happened.

Article 16.Automated decisions and human review
The Platform uses rules and scores to calculate the suggested price, estimate demand, rank
eligible drivers, detect fraud and apply cancellation limits. These criteria take into account,
among other factors, proximity, vehicle type, availability, documentation status, rating,
acceptance rate, cancellation rate, operating balance and idle time.
Right to review
Any decision that suspends, limits or blocks an account, or applies a penalty, may be
submitted for human review. Simply write to the channels in Article 22,
identifying the account and the decision in question. The review is carried out by a member
of the team, not by the system that made the decision, and the outcome is communicated with
reasons.
These criteria exist to deliver and protect the service. They are not used to make automated
decisions that by themselves produce legal effects unrelated to the transportation
relationship.
Article 17.Trip and payment disputes
Where one party denies that payment was made, or the confirmation period expires without a
response, the Platform opens a dispute and the trip is marked accordingly.
The support team reviews the trip record —route, statuses, timestamps, messages and
confirmations— and decides. The outcome may include treating the payment as made, keeping the
debt on record, refunding the commission to the driver, or applying a measure to the account of
the party that acted in bad faith.
Because DriverX does not hold the trip fare, it cannot refund it. A claim about
the fare is settled between the parties; the Platform provides the record of what happened and
applies the measures within its own remit to the accounts.
Claims must be submitted within thirty days of the trip. After that period there may not be
enough information to review them, in line with the retention periods in the Privacy Policy.
